Page 2: Digipak planning

The front cover…

This is a midshot of Hannah wearing her burgundy hat which she will be seen wearing in the actual music video of the song ‘Afterglow’. As this is the main song which is well known by audiences of the album I feel it is important to use something they are familiar with so they recognise this is the album for Wilkinson's songs. I have also used this approach when naming the album, ‘smoke and lazers’ as this is a lyric from the song Afterglow and may also mean that buyers will recognise the song and choose to by the album. I feel using a mid shot/close up is important as it allows the audience to see the emotions of the actor in this case. Also, Hannahs eyes will be looking down the camera lense, which will make the audience feel that she is looking straight at them, possibly making them feel intrigued enough to pick up the album and purchase it.

Page 3: Digipak planning

This is the picture I will use for the CD compartment and the CD itself. This image was taken on my camera phone whilst I was at Wireless festival watching a dance act. I feel this image is successful as it gives the definition of the CD’s name ‘smoke and lasers’ in a picture. The picture includes both laser lights and smoke and also captures people dancing together and enjoy themselves (One of the contrasting narratives in my music video).

Page 4: Digipak planning

This a drawing of Hannah with her hands covering her face as the alcohol she has drunk has made her feel ill and confused about where she is and what she is doing. I plan to use this as an image in my digipak as I will be using many shots of Hannah holding her face in her hands in the actual music video. This again could allow the audience to make a connection between the music video for Afterglow and also the CD which has many other songs on it. The colour of this picture will be taken in low-key lighting to give the feel of the negative sides of alcohol. This image will also contrast the previous picture taken at the festival where everyone is together having fun, Where as Hannah is alone and not having fun at all. The two pictures will reinforce the narrative of the music video for Afterglow via the CD.

Page 5: Digipak planning

This would be the back of the digipak. This is a drawing on Hannah with her back to the camera and holding her hat in her hand. The songs and what number they are can be found next to the image. Possible colours of the text will include, black, grey, white or purple. This will be decided later, when I have chosen the colour scheme of my poster which will advertise the song.
